When I was a child my grandmother every Easter made us a bunny cake for our dessert at Easter dinner. I was always amazed that it was shaped like a bunny because to the best of my knowledge they didn't have cake pans back then in the different shapes they do now. Her delicious bunny cake was decorated with shredded coconut and it was so good! It has been a childhood memory that has stood the test of time and stayed with me all these years.
